CVE-2024-38112

HIGHCVSS 7.5/10Actively ExploitedEPSS 84.34%

Last modified

CVE-2024-38112 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 7.5/10 on the CVSS scale. Windows MSHTML Platform Spoofing Vulnerability. CISA has confirmed active exploitation in the wild. EPSS estimates a 84.34%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.

Affected Software

VendorProductVersionsUpdate
MicrosoftWindows 10 1507< 10.0.10240.20710
MicrosoftWindows 10 1607< 10.0.14393.7159
MicrosoftWindows 10 1809< 10.0.17763.6054
MicrosoftWindows 10 21h2< 10.0.19044.4651
MicrosoftWindows 10 22h2< 10.0.19045.4651
MicrosoftWindows 11 21h2< 10.0.22000.3079
MicrosoftWindows 11 22h2< 10.0.22621.3880
MicrosoftWindows 11 23h2< 10.0.22631.3880
MicrosoftWindows Server 2008All versionsSp2
MicrosoftWindows Server 2012r2
MicrosoftWindows Server 2016< 10.0.14393.7159
MicrosoftWindows Server 2019< 10.0.17763.6054
MicrosoftWindows Server 2022< 10.0.20348.2582
MicrosoftWindows Server 2022 23h2< 10.0.25398.1009
